I am using Excel 2007 in XP home sp3.
I have a printout with salesman names and their sales for the week. Can I scan that sheet of names and numbers into a scanner and have it end up in the correct place in the worksheet in Excel 2007. |

Depends entirely upon your scanner and the efficacy of the OCR application
that came with it. My HP scanner is very good in this respect but has no direct scan to Excel. I scan as Text to a *.txt file then open that in Excel.
